Tesla adds 204 supercharge piles, improving the charging system

It is reported that in August, Tesla launched a total of 23 supercharge sites in 15 cities in China, adding a total of 204 superchargers. Among them, there is a V3 supercharged pile located in Beijing China Central Place.

Tesla plans to build a total of 4,000 super charging piles in China in 2020 and is improving the domestic charging system to make charging more convenient and faster. Prior to this, the announced V3 charging pile has been operated.

According to the official data provided by Tesla, taking the Tesla Model 3 as an example, charging the Model 3 at the V3 super charging station for 15 minutes can supplement the cruising range of more than 200km. The biggest difference between the V3 super charging station and the V2 and V1 charging stations is that the V3 super charging pile adopts a new liquid-cooled wire and charging plug. With a better cooling effect, the V3 charging with new power electronic components is used. The pile can charge the vehicle with a larger current, thereby further shortening the charging time.

In addition to the increase in charging power, the liquid-cooled cables of the V3 Super Charging Pile have also been optimized. Compared with the wires of the V2 super charging pile, the liquid-cooled wires of the V3 super charging pile are two-thirds smaller in diameter, and the weight has been greatly reduced.
